The first historical mentions of the Teufelsbäck date back to the 17th century. More precisely, this refers to the area of today’s Batterie and Ziegelgasse. Today, the Hotel Brunner and the bar, bistro and wine bar Atelier Teufelsbäck are located here.

A whiff of nostalgia blows over us as we enter the Teufelsbäck studio under the time-honored copper shield of the former Litten wine tavern. Under this impression we arrive at the guest room, which skilfully exudes a warm and cozy flair. Loving details such as historical photos of Amberg on the interior, modern photos of the city on the tables and small works of art in the effectively illuminated niches inspire us. The highlight, however, is the fascinating glass mosaic “Amirage” with a very special view of Amberg by the artists Marion Mack and Marcus Trepesch.
The counter is lovingly decorated with twitter box and tastefully presented wine of the week. Behind the bar, we discover an exquisite selection of Bavarian spirits that awaken even more feelings of home.
Passing originally designed washrooms, we finally enter the beer garden, which is the venue for numerous concerts in summer – true to the motto “Teufelsbäck LIVE”. The surrounding masonry is overgrown with ivy and small flower beds give off the air of a quiet oasis in the heart of the city. On two levels, you can find peace from everyday life with exuberant conversations.
A look at the lovingly designed menu reveals not only a wide range of wines, but also homemade dishes that make our mouths water. International cuisine meets regional delicacies, we even discover vegan meals.
